Parallel tensioning device of glass fiber protofilament cylinder

A parallel tensioning device of a glass fiber protofilament comprises a plurality of blades. The blades distributed on the circumference are hinged to a connecting rod support through a double-row connecting rod mechanism, the connecting rod support is connected with a central shaft, a connecting rod sliding sleeve can be installed on the central shaft along the central shaft in a sliding mode, and the connecting rod sliding sleeve is connected with the double-row connecting rod mechanism; a compression spring is arranged between the connecting rod support and the connecting rod sliding sleeve; one side, far away from the connecting rod sliding sleeve, of the connecting rod sliding sleeve is provided with a plurality of air cylinders driving the connecting rod sliding sleeve to slide along the central shaft; the other end of each air cylinder is connected with an air cylinder base. According to the parallel tensioning device of the glass fiber protofilament, an adopted quadrilateral mechanism is flexible in rotation, so that generated tension is even and the tensioning force is large. The torque of transmission of the double-row connecting rod mechanism is large, the driving blades are driven to enable the range of the tensioning diameter to be wide, and the parallel tensioning device is suitable for glass fiber protofilaments with different diameters. Due to the fact that the blades are supported by two connecting rods, the binding face is large, roundness is good, tensioning of the protofilament is even, and when the parallel tensioning device rotates, the phenomenon of looseness is avoided. The parallel tensioning device of the glass fiber protofilament is extremely suitable for active unwinding in the process of ultra-fine monofilament glass fibers.

Control rope tensioning device

The invention provides a control rope tensioning device. The control rope tensioning device comprises a carrier plate, a rope feeding assembly used for guiding a control rope to move is installed on one side face of the carrier plate, a first rope locking assembly used for preventing the control rope from rebounding is arranged obliquely below the rope feeding assembly, a second rope locking assembly used for preventing the control rope from rebounding is installed on the side, away from the first rope locking assembly, of one side face of the carrier plate, a first conical wheel and a secondconical wheel which rotate oppositely and are used for tensioning the control rope are arranged between the first rope locking assembly and the second rope locking assembly, the side, facing the carrier plate, of the first conical wheel is connected with the output end of a first gear motor through a rotating shaft, and the side, facing the carrier plate, of the second conical wheel is connected with the output end of a second gear motor through a rotating shaft. Compared with the prior art, the control rope tensioning device has the following beneficial effects that the tensioned control ropeis prevented from rebounding, the tensioning efficiency of the control rope is improved, step-by-step tensioning is achieved, and the stress of the control rope is evenly increased.

Precision detection device for optical fiber gyroscope production

The invention discloses a precision detection device for optical fiber gyroscope production, and relates to the technical field of optical fiber gyroscopes. The problem of axis deviation of an existing detection device is solved. The precision detection device specifically comprises a bottom plate, the outer wall of the top of the bottom plate is fixedly connected with an adjusting assembly, the outer wall of the top of the adjusting assembly is fixedly connected with a locking assembly, the locking assembly comprises a connecting plate and an end frame, the outer wall of the top of the connecting plate is fixedly connected with a cover shell, and the inner wall of the top of the cover shell is fixedly connected with an upper ring. By arranging the locking assembly, a power motor is started to drive an outer gear to rotate, the outer gear is meshed with an outer rack to drive a lantern ring to rotate, then an inner rack is meshed with an inner gear to drive a rotary drum to rotate, and a rotary arm rotates, so that a roller on the inner wall of an end frame is gradually tightened; at the moment, the optical fiber gyroscope is placed in the center area of the locking assembly, and the four power motors synchronously work, so that the roller can be uniformly tightened, and the axis of the gyroscope is prevented from deviating.

Pipe cutting device used for cutting line pipe

The invention discloses a pipe cutting device used for cutting a line pipe. The pipe cutting device comprises an installing shell provided with a cavity inside, an installing sleeve installed on the installing shell in a rotating manner, a force exerting part installed on the installing shell in a rotating manner, a transmission part and a cutting part, wherein the transmission part is located inthe installing shell and connects the installing sleeve with the force exerting part, and the cutting part is installed on the installing sleeve. The cutting part comprises a sleeve ring which is fixedly connected to the end, away from the transmission part, of the installing sleeve. Elastic clamping pieces are uniformly arranged on the sleeve ring at intervals. Cutting teeth are fixedly connectedto the sides, facing the axis of the sleeve ring, of the elastic clamping pieces. Fixing parts for stringing all the elastic clamping pieces as a whole are arranged on the outer sides of the elasticclamping pieces. The pipe cutting device used for cutting the line pipe can carry out ring cutting on the line pipe, the pipe shearing efficiency is improved, and the problems that a traditional toolis high in construction cost and labor is wasted are solved.
